On 06/04/2010 04:42 PM, Kamal Mostafa wrote: > As noted by Andy, the fix for "Dell Studio 155x hangs on resume" was > (again) not included in the official kernel just released. The reason > is because the last three kernel releases have been security-fix-only > releases (rush jobs) and have not included any of the growing list of > patches queued up for the next 'regular' kernel release. No action is > needed to make sure this fix gets released (eventually) -- this patch > got re-queued automatically and is now available in the latest pre- > release PPA kernel. > > To summarize: > > The latest released Lucid kernel DOES NOT include this fix: > 2.6.32-22-generic #36-Ubuntu > > The pre-release PPA Lucid kernel (#37) DOES include this fix (for "Dell > Studio 155x" only): > https://launchpad.net/~kernel-ppa/+archive/pre-proposed/ > > Note also that I'm working on custom re-spin build which will also > include my "i915 brightness" fix (for non-working brightness keys). > > -- Intel Core i3/i5/i7 hang on resume from suspend (SCI_EN) https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/553498 You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u Bugs, which is subscribed to Ubuntu. -- ubuntu-bugs mailing list ubuntu-bugs@lists.ubuntu.com https://lists.ubuntu.com/mailman/listinfo/ubuntu-bugs
